11 THE SENATE S.B. NO. 2729 THIRTY-SECOND LEGISLATURE, 2024 STATE OF HAWAII A BILL FOR AN ACT relating to emergency management. BE IT ENACTED BY THE LEGISLATURE OF THE STATE OF HAWAII:

4747 SECTION 1. Section 127A-2, Hawaii Revised Statutes, is amended by amending the definition of "emergency" to read as follows: ""Emergency" means [any] an acute occurrence, or imminent threat thereof, which results or may likely result in substantial injury or harm to the population or substantial damage to or loss of property or substantial damage to or loss of the environment[.], and the occurrence cannot be handled by laws adopted by the legislature and signed by the governor due to the time constraints." SECTION 2. Statutory material to be repealed is bracketed and stricken. New statutory material is underscored. SECTION 3. This Act shall take effect upon its approval. 7373 Report Title: Emergency Management; Emergency; Definition; Acute Occurrences Description: Amends the definition of "emergency" for emergency management purposes to mean an acute occurrence, or imminent threat thereof, which results or may likely result in substantial injury or harm to the population or substantial damage to or loss of property or substantial damage to or loss of the environment, and the occurrence cannot be handled by laws adopted by the Legislature and signed by the Governor due to the time constraints.
